Jumping out of bed in the morning and spending a few quiet moments in the backyard is one of my favourite things to do in summer.
Getting out in nature and appreciating the beauty that surrounds me, helps to relieve stress, lower blood pressure and stress hormones, clear my mind, boost my mood and immune system, support my microbiome (thereby improving digestion and probably everything else) and can also help to slow down a racing mind.
All for free.

I’m Diane Murphy, Nutritionist for women who are living with or recovering from breast cancer. One of the first things I help her to do, is to try her hand at juicing if she hasn't done it before.
Why start with juicing?
Developing habits are key for a sustainable nutrition plan. Jumping in with both feet and doing EVERYTHING at the start can get incredibly overwhelming so I pick juicing to start, if she’s ready for it.
Our goal is to help saturate her healthy cells with loads of nutrients….QUICKLY.
Cancer thrives in a nutrient deficient body and a lack of vitamins, minerals, antioxidants etc. leave the cells less able to repair themselves against damage from medications, treatment, environmental toxins, diet, stress and of course cancer itself.
While throwing the veggies in a blender and making a smoothie can be very nutritious, the fibre in the veggies (plus additional protein and healthy fat) will fill her up too fast. She can get more from her juice. She doesn’t lose out on the fibre, she just eats it later on in the day.
What does she juice?
The general rule of thumb is to EAT fruit and JUICE veggies. Some great veggies to start with that aren't usually too gassy (like cabbage can be) are cucumbers, celery, carrots, beets (and the beet greens), kale, spinach, fresh turmeric and fresh ginger.However, green apples are low glycemic and add a really nice flavour.
How much does she juice?
This depends if she has active cancer or not, if she is in the middle of treatment or not, does she have an appetite or not…so we work this out together.
